Cleaning windows made of upvc
Cleaning windows made of uPVC after repairs is possible with just a few steps. To avoid damaging your uPVC windows, it is vital to employ a non-abrasive cleaner. You must also ensure that the product is diluted properly to ensure that you get the right concentration.
The best way to clean UPVC windows is by using an easy liquid detergent. It is recommended to clean your windows at least twice each month. Another good idea is to wash windows at minimum every four to eight times during the year.
You can make use of bleach in diluted form to get rid of tough stains. A mixture of vinegar and hot water can also help you clean your windows. If you have the time you're allowed to leave the solution on your window for about 15 minutes and then wipe off any excess with a towel.
White uPVC windows can lose their shine after a couple of years. If you want to restore the shine, you can use traditional glass cleaner.
You can also use the specialized uPVC cleaning product. These are available in hardware stores or on the internet. Make sure that the product you purchase doesn't damage the seals of silicone or double glazing. The wrong products can cause irreparable damage to your uPVC.
Regular cleaning of uPVC windows is crucial to avoid mould and dirt buildup. Regularly cleaning your UPVC windows will decrease the need for repairing or replacing your window.
Mold growth can be slowed by keeping your uPVC frames and windows clean. It will also save you money on repair costs. uPVC can be extremely durable and low-maintenance if maintained properly.
